Cooked Rice — Cups in Grams

How many grams of cooked rice in 1 cup?

1 cup of cooked rice equals 250 grams*

About cooked rice measurements

Once rice absorbs water it becomes denser than its dry form — about 1.06 g/ml, roughly 250 g per US cup. How firmly it is packed swings the weight most: loosely fluffed grains fall short of a cup pressed down, and stickier short-grain rice compresses more than fluffy long-grain.
